  • Glacial acetic acid is also employed as a reagent in titrations, especially acid-base titrations. It serves as a weak acid and can be used to determine the concentration of basic substances in a solution. Through titration, chemists can analyze and quantify the amount of an unknown base by neutralizing it with a measured amount of glacial acetic acid. The endpoint of such titrations is crucial for determining various chemical properties and concentrations, making it an indispensable tool in quantitative analysis.

    The unique properties of glacial acetic acid are a result of its molecular structure. The molecule comprises a carboxylic acid group (-COOH), which is responsible for its acidic behavior. At higher concentrations, glacial acetic acid does not dissociate completely but maintains a significant number of undissociated molecules, primarily due to its high viscosity and hydrogen bonding. This behavior differs considerably from diluted acetic acid, commonly found in household vinegar, where it is present in a solution with a much lower concentration of acetic acid.
